IN MEMORIAM

MCALISTER.—In loving memory or my dear mother, who died December 14. 1941. Not a day do I forget you. In my heart you are always there, dear mother; I who loved you sadly miss you, As It dawns the second sad year. —lnserted by her loving daughter, Muriel. %il McALISTER.—In loving memory of dear grandma, who died December 1 I, 1941. Not Just today, but every day; In silence I remember you. —lnserted by her loving grandson, Gra. MORRIS, John.—ln memory of Dad. Made of unpurchasable stuff. He went the way, when ways were rough. —George, Samrney and grandchildren. SHAW.—In loving memory of Doreen, who passed away December 14. 1933. Ever remembered. —lnserted by her loving parents. 488
